Abstract: Maleic anhydride is produced by the oxidation of 1,3-butadiene, n-butylenes, crotonaldehyde and furan with molecular oxygen in the vapor phase in the presence of catalytic oxides of antimony, molybdenum, at least one element selected from the group consisting of niobium, zirconium, titanium and tantalum and optionally a reducing agent capable of reducing at least part of the molybdenum in the catalyst to a valence state below +6 selected from the group consisting of hydrazine hydrate, molybdenum, tungsten, magnesium, aluminum, and nickel. This catalyst may optionally contain one or more elements selected from the group consisting of Li, Ag, Ce, Cd, Co, As, Si, Zn, Ge, Bi, Ru, Pt, U, Al and Ni. Especially desirable yields of maleic anhydride are obtained from 1,3-butadiene in the presence of a catalyst wherein molybdenum metal is used as a reducing agent.

Abstract: Vanadium-free catalysts consisting essentially of oxides of titanium and phosphorus have been found to be especially effective in the oxidation of n-butane, n-butenes and 1,3-butadiene with molecular oxygen in the vapor phase to yield maleic anhydride. The reaction with n-butane gives an especially pure product in good yield and selectivity.

Abstract: PREPARATION OF MALEIC ANHYDRIDE FROM FOUR-CARBON HYDROCARBONS Maleic anhydride is produced by the oxidation of n-butane, n-butenes, 1,3-butadiene with molecular oxygen in the vapor phase in the presence of catalysts containing molybdenum, phosphorus, oxygen and the following components delineated in Groups I to IV: (I) bismuth, copper and a halogen selected from the group consisting of chlorine, bromine or iodine; or (II) arsenic and at least one element selected from the group consisting of Sn, rare earth metal, Zr, Rh, Mn, Re, Ru, Cu, Pb, Zn, Ti, Cr, Nb, Al, Ga and alkaline earth metal; or (III) at least one element selected from the group consisting of As, Rb, Pd, Cd, Cs, Tl and In; or (IV) rubidium, and at least one element selected from the group consisting of Sn, rare earth element, Ni, Zr, Ba, Fe, Rh, Mn, Re, Ru, Co and Cu.

Abstract: Maleic anhydride and acrylic acid are produced by the oxidation of 1,3-butadiene, n-butylenes, crotonaldehyde and furan with molecular oxygen in the vapor phase in the presence of a catalytic oxide of antimony, molybdenum, vanadium and lithium, cerium, or mixture thereof, wherein one element selected from the group consisting of calcium, iron, tungsten, magnesium, aluminum and nickel is optionally added as a reducing agent. The oxidation of 1,3-butadiene in the presence of a catalyst wherein tungsten metal is used as a reducing agent gives especially desirable high yields to maleic anhydride.

Abstract: OXIDATION OF PROPYLENE AND ISOBUTYLENE TO OBTAIN THE CORRESPONDING UNSATURATED ALDEHYDES AND ACIDS Very desirable temperature control in the oxidation of propylene or isobutylene in a fixed-bed, tubular reactor is obtained by using an oxidation catalyst having two physical forms. me first catalyst which initially contacts the reactants is an essentially inert support having a strongly adhering coat of a catalytic material, and the second catalyst that contacts the reactants after contact with the first catalyst consists essentially of the catalytic material.
